Analysis: McCullers has had a tremendous rookie season, posting a 2.48 ERA (3.43 SIERA) with a strikeout rate of 25.0%. He does walk a lot of batters, but we can live with it as long as he is striking out one in every four batters that he faces. He draws a difficult matchup tonight against the Rangers, who are ranked eighth in team wOBA against right-handed pitching. The price point may be appealing, but he has to face a capable offense in a hitter-friendly ballpark.

Analysis: Lewis hasn’t been as bad as his 5.34 ERA over the last month would suggest, but he’s still not a pitcher that should be on our radar anytime soon. He has struggled with hitters from both sides of the plate this season and tonight he faces an Astros’ offense that leads the majors in home runs. Lewis is an easy pitcher to avoid in all league formats tonight.

Analysis: Ross has pitched well in his recent starts, posting a 2.66 SIERA with a strikeout rate of 26.0% over the last month of play. He had a thigh injury that shortened his last start, but it sounds like he should be ready to go for tonight’s game against the Brewers. The Brewers have been a subpar offense all season long and that’s only going to get worse now that they have traded away Carlos Gomez and Gerardo Parra. Ross has good strikeout upside in this matchup and he makes an excellent tournament play on both FanDuel and DraftKings.

Analysis: Peralta has been a good starter for the Brewers over the last two seasons, posting a 3.80 SIERA with a strikeout rate of 17.6%. The biggest problem with Peralta is that he is a fly-ball pitcher that struggles to keep the ball in the park. The good news is that the Padres don’t hit a ton of home runs and they strikeout at the fifth-highest rate against right-handed pitching this season. This is the perfect matchup for Peralta, but this is only his second start in over a month, so rust could be an issue.

Analysis: Karns has pitched well in his recent starts, posting a 3.33 SIERA with a strikeout rate of 23.2%. He has improved his command as the season has progressed and he has kept his strikeout rate well above the 20% mark that we like to see from our starting pitchers. The issue here is his matchup. After three months of disappointment, the White Sox offense has caught fire recently, ranking third in team wOBA over the last 14 days. If this game was at home, it would be another story, but I will avoid Karns on the road tonight against a red-hot White Sox offense.

Analysis: It’s funny how big of an impact a ballpark can have on pitching. If this game was being played in Safeco Field, Hernandez would be the chalk play in cash games tonight. With this game being played in Coors Field, he is a tournament play at best. We never like to target pitchers in Coors Field, especially in cash games. Even though Hernandez can dominate any lineup, I will not be targeting him tonight in a game that features a total of 9.5 runs.

Analysis: Wilson will be making his second career start tonight. Since his major league sample is so small, let’s take a look at how well he performed in the minors. In 16 starts at the Triple-A level this season, Wilson posted a 3.76 FIP with a strikeout rate of 15.7%. Those numbers aren’t terrible, but they aren’t anything to write home about either (do we say text home about these days? Tweet home about?). I like to take a wait-and-see approach with most young pitchers and that’s exactly what I will do with Wilson.
